--An executive from Google will tell a U.S. Senate committee the company made mistakes on privacy issues, Reuters reported Tuesday.

--Citing a document they reviewed, Reuters said Google's chief privacy officer Keith Enright will tell the committee, "We acknowledge that we have made mistakes in the past, from which we have learned, and improved our robust privacy program."
